For anyone who has looked to play Red Alert 2: Yuri's Revenge online, there is a high chance you have encountered the term "gamemd.exe" along with the request to ensure your game is patched to "1.001." The gamemd.exe file is the main engine executable for the Yuri's Revenge expansion pack. It runs the core game logic, from unit movement and projectile physics to resource collection and base building.

gamemd.exe -patched to version 1.001-: Ensuring the Ultimate Red Alert 2 Experience

While the game can run on the original 1.000 version, the 1.001 patch is crucial as the community standard. The 1.000 version is often unstable online and riddled with exploits. Crucially, many game modifications and modern launchers, like the CnCNet client, are designed to interface directly with the 1.001 executable. Attempting to run a mod like Mental Omega or a client like CnCNet on a 1.000 version will result in the game failing to launch entirely.

If you purchased the Command & Conquer The Ultimate Collection on Steam or the EA App, your gamemd.exe is already at version 1.001 by default. You do not need to hunt down old standalone .exe patchers.

When Westwood Studios released the Yuri's Revenge expansion package in the autumn of 2001, the primary game launcher executable was logged as version 1.000. While playable, the initial release suffered from multiplayer balance anomalies and minor logic engine bugs.

The file is the primary executable launch file for Command & Conquer: Red Alert 2 - Yuri’s Revenge , the critically acclaimed expansion pack to Red Alert 2 . While the base game runs on ra2.exe , the expansion utilizes gamemd.exe to manage its unique assets, psychic factions, campaign triggers, and multiplayer logic.
